No, monozygotic twins would be the same sex. Monozygotic twins come from one single fertilized egg, or zygote, which then splits to create two separate zygotes which will be genetically identical, or "identical twins", which will always be of the same gender.

During anaphase in a human intestinal cell, there are 92 chromosomes. During anaphase, the 92 chromosomes are separating into two sets of 46, so that at the end of mitosis, there will be two genetically identical nuclei, each containing 46 chromosomes. As the new nuclei are forming, the cytoplasm splits in the process of cytokinesis, resulting in two genetically identical daughter cells, each having 46 chromosomes.
